Industry billing guidance
Make your recruiting invoice easier to review and pay
Use this recruiting quote template to turn a search brief into a clear commercial scope. It separates sourcing, screening, shortlist delivery, and placement fees so the client can see what is billed at each stage and which event triggers the final fee.
Best for
- Contingency, retained, and fixed-fee recruitment projects
- Candidate sourcing, screening, and shortlist delivery
- Single-role searches and multi-role hiring assignments
Line item ideas
- Separate upfront, milestone, and placement-based fees
- Use line details for the role, stage, and agreed deliverable
- List approved advertising or assessment costs separately
Helpful notes
- Define the event that makes each fee payable
- Reference replacement, cancellation, and exclusivity terms
- Avoid adding candidate personal data that billing staff do not need
